Summary

This grant program provides financial support to strengthen community well-being and support individuals connected to local service industries. Funding is generally available within areas where participating organizations operate across the United States. The resources are intended to improve access to education, support workforce development, and assist with essential needs during times of hardship. Community-focused funding is also directed toward nonprofit-led initiatives that address food insecurity, youth development, and local stability efforts. The overall benefit of the program is to promote long-term growth, personal advancement, and stronger communities through targeted, flexible financial assistance.
